Understanding Fur and Air Quality
Fur, whether from pets or textiles, can significantly impact air quality. When fur dries and sheds, tiny particles become airborne, contributing to indoor air pollution. These fur particles, along with dander and other allergens, can trigger allergies and respiratory issues for sensitive individuals. Understanding this relationship is crucial in creating a healthier living environment, especially for pet owners.
Air purifiers designed to be fur-friendly employ advanced filters and technologies to trap these small particles effectively. High-efficiency particulate air (HEPA) filters, for instance, are known for their ability to capture 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, including pet dander and fur. Additionally, some purifiers use activated carbon filters to absorb odors and volatile organic compounds (VOCs), further enhancing air quality in homes with furry companions.
Key Features of Pet-Friendly Air Purifiers
When looking for pet-friendly air purifiers, consider models designed with specific features to cater to your furry companions’ needs. Look for high-efficiency particulate filters (HEPs) that can trap tiny particles like pet dander, fur, and pollen, ensuring a cleaner air environment. Activated carbon filters are also beneficial as they absorb odors and gases, reducing the presence of common pet smells. These dual-stage filtration systems work together to capture both visible allergens and microscopic ones, providing relief for pets with allergies or respiratory issues.
Additionally, smart sensors can be a valuable addition, automatically adjusting settings based on air quality, ensuring optimal performance without excessive energy use. Some purifiers also offer adjustable speed controls, allowing you to customize the fan speed according to your preferences and those of your pets. This feature is particularly useful for quieter operations during sleep or playtime.
